How to Replace a Dead BMW Key Fob

Land-Rover.pngAlmost every BMW owner will have to replace their key fob battery at some point in time. This is a simple task that won't cost a fortune. The key fob is powered by the standard CR2032 and can be replaced at the local BMW dealer or online, or at the hardware store.

Replacement Battery

A lost key fob could be more than an inconvenience; it could also be dangerous. You don't want to go up to your car, hit the unlock button, and then find that nothing happens. This is usually a sign that the battery inside your BMW key fob has died. Luckily, this is easy to fix at home using the replacement battery. The first step is to identify which kind of battery you BMW key fob requires - either an one that is CR2450 (Smart Key) or a one of the CR2032 (Comfort Slant Keys with Access/sleek Shapes). These batteries can be found in auto parts and hardware shops for less than $5 each.

Once you have the correct type of battery, all that is left to do is replace the old battery for the new one. Make sure to shut the two halves of your key fob securely once you have inserted the new battery.

Remove the blade made of metal from the BMW key fob. Use a valet or flat screwdriver to take it off and reveal the tiny port in the back. Then, you can pop off the back and replace the dead batteries. When you remove the key fob, you must be careful not to damage the plastic. Wrapping a small amount of tape around the edge of the tool will protect against scratches.

After replacing the battery you must reassemble and check your BMW key fob. If your door locks and opens the car, then you have successfully reprogrammed your BMW key fob! If not, you might need to consult your owner's manual or visit an expert for assistance.

Programming

If the replacement BMW key fob comes with a brand new battery, but it's not working as it should, you may require reprogramming it. Our service team in San Diego will guide you through the procedure. Begin by inserting your working key into the ignition. Turn it five times quickly from position zero to position one. Then take the key out of the ignition and press the unlock button (the BMW Logo) on the new keys. Within 30 seconds, you should press the BMW logo three times. Then press the unlock button, and you should be able to hear the doors locking automatically and unlock.

The programming process for the replacement BMW keyfob is exactly the same as for other BMW models. It will take less than 30 seconds to complete. Once you've finished you can begin to drive your car with the new key.
